#e640d2 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#e640d2 is composed of 90.2% red, 25.1% green and 82.4%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 72.2% magenta, 8.7% yellow and 9.8% black. It has a hue angle of 307.2 degrees, a saturation of 76.9% and a lightness of 57.6%. #e640d2 color hex could be obtained by blending #ff80ff with #cd00a5. Closest websafe color is: #ff33cc.

#e640d2 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#e640d2 has RGB values of R:230, G:64, B:210 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.72, Y:0.09, K:0.1. Its decimal value is 15089874.

Shades and Tints of #e640d2
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#11020f is the darkest color, while #ffffff is the lightest one.

Tones of #e640d2
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#9b8b99 is the less saturated color, while #ff27e5 is the most saturated one.
